How the Smart Lock That Changes Everything Actually Works
Image Gallery
Key Insights
At its core, a smart lock replaces key-based entry with secure, digital authentication—often blending password PINs, Bluetooth pairing, or biometric data like fingerprint scans. Unlike traditional locks, it connects seamlessly to smartphones and automated home systems, letting users lock and unlock doors via encrypted apps, set temporary access codes for guests, and receive real-time alerts when someone tries to enter. The setup is straightforward: many models offer plug-and-play installation, reducing reliance on skilled locksmiths. Security protocols are built to withstand hacking attempts, using end-to-end encryption and tamper-resistant hardware. This blend of simplicity, connectivity, and safety creates a system that evolves with homeowner needs—without sacrificing reliability.
Common Questions About Why Every Homeowner Is Switching to the Smart Lock That Changes Everything
How secure are smart locks compared to traditional ones?
Smart locks use military-grade encryption, multi-factor authentication, and frequent software updates to stay ahead of cyber threats—far surpassing the vulnerability of physical keys or basic mechanical locks.
Can I use a smart lock without Wi-Fi?
Most models offer Bluetooth connectivity for basic control but require internet access via cellular or home network for remote features—though some hybrid systems still function securely offline for essential locking.
Are smart locks easy to maintain?
Yes. Many require no special care beyond periodic battery checks and firmware updates. With user-friendly apps, even non-tech-savvy homeowners can manage access and monitor activity effortlessly.

What happens during a power outage?
Battery-backed models retain function for days, allowing secure entry even without grid power—though full remote control may pause until power returns.
Are smart locks affordable for everyday homeowners?
Prices vary, but technological maturity has made affordable entry-level options common. Many offer flexible pricing with subscription tiers that balance cost and capability.
What Concerns Should Homeowners Have When Switching?
While smart locks bring clear benefits, realistic expectations are essential. Reliance on connectivity means occasional app glitches can occur, though most brands include backup mechanisms. Privacy is another key point—data from smart locks is typically encrypted, but using trusted brands with strong security credentials helps ensure protection. Integration with existing home systems also requires careful setup but is manageable with clear guidance.
